LONG SERVICE MEDAL
NEW CONDITIONS OF AWARD. Amended regulations were gazetted recently dealing with trie granting of the New Zeaian.i Tong and Efficient Service Medal. It is provided now that the medal will be uwaruecl to ah members ox the New 'Zealand Military Forces who have served efficiently in (i.e same for sixteen consecutive year.-, or lor a total period of 2U years, which need not necessarily be consecutive. Senior cadet- will be allowed to count onehull of their efficient service in the senior cadets a.s qualifying service, but those ovet the age oi LS years who have been retained for service as senior cutlet n.c.o.’s will be creffited with full time service, if such lie I efficient, performed by them subsequent to the date on which they were due for postl ing in the Territorial Force. Half the period of efficient service in the Territorial Force Reserve will be admitted as qualifying service. Providing applicants were members of the New Zealand Military Forces during the period, their active service overseas will be counted twofold. Active service during the war of 1914-19 will be computed from date of embarkation from New Zealand to date of disembarkation on return, or date of discharge overseas, or date of declaration of Peace (28th June, 1919), whichever be the earliest. Applicants also will be credited with efficient service during such time as they may have actually served (a) as members of the N.Z.E.F. in New Zealand; (b) as members of the Temporary Staff of the New Zealand Forces subsequent to sth August, 1914; or (c) as officers with Territorial units having been called up for such duty temporarily, subsequent to sth August, 1914, irrespective of the fact that they may have been at. the time officers on the Reserve of Officers or Retired List. The colour of the riband of the medal wall be crimson, with two white strines down the centre.
